Evaluate using the values given.
ZX - [z - (4 + x)/6] when x = 2, z = 6

Respuesta :

randomperson77
randomperson77 randomperson77
  • 03-10-2020

Answer:

7

Step-by-step explanation:

First, you should replace the variables with the numbers. So,

2(6)-[6-(4+2)/6]

Don't worry, it'll look less confusing later! Next, solve the parentheses that are in the very middle.

2(6)-[6-6/6]

2(6)-[6-1]

12-5

7
